The Disco Legacy Behind Frieda & Freddies' Distinctive Design Philosophy

Origins in Miami and New York Nightlife Culture

The 1970s disco scene that birthed Frieda & Freddies wasn't just about music—it was a cultural explosion of self-expression, vibrant color, and unapologetic glamour. The brand emerged from this electric atmosphere, capturing the essence of nights filled with sequins, statement fashion, and the belief that clothing should make people feel alive. That foundational spirit never left; it simply evolved and refined itself over the decades.

From Disco Excess to European Sensibilities

The 2005 revival marked a pivotal moment. The brand received a fresh, youthful makeover specifically tailored for the European market, stripping away some of the original excess while maintaining the core identity. This evolution proved that the disco DNA—boldness, quality, distinctiveness—could thrive in contemporary fashion without feeling dated or costumey.

Caring for Your Investment: Maintenance and Longevity Tips

Material-Specific Cleaning Approaches

Down coats require professional dry cleaning to maintain loft and insulation properties—home washing risks damaging the fill structure. Quilted jackets often tolerate gentle machine washing on delicate cycles, though professional cleaning extends their lifespan. Faux fur demands special handling with appropriate products designed for synthetic fibers to maintain texture and appearance.

Off-Season Storage Strategy

Proper storage transforms a jacket's lifespan significantly. Store in breathable garment bags rather than plastic, which traps moisture. Keep in cool, dry spaces away from direct sunlight. Down coats benefit from occasional fluffing to restore loft; quilted pieces should hang rather than fold to maintain their construction integrity.

Professional Care Versus Home Maintenance

While professional dry cleaning costs money, it's an investment in longevity. Quarterly professional cleaning removes accumulated dirt and environmental particles that degrade materials. Between professional cleanings, spot-treat stains immediately and use a soft brush to remove surface dust from quilted or faux fur pieces.

Addressing Wear Patterns

Small repairs catch problems before they become serious. A loose button repaired immediately prevents stress on surrounding stitching. Minor seam separations warrant immediate attention. This proactive approach transforms a jacket with five years of wear into one that could realistically last ten.
